The Pines Country Club – Morgantown, West Virginia

The Pines Country Club, a premier private club in the heart of Morgantown, WV, is seeking an experienced and motivated Golf Course Superintendent to lead its golf course maintenance operations. This individual will oversee all aspects of agronomy, turf management, and team development for the club’s 18-hole championship golf course and surrounding property. The Superintendent will play a critical leadership role in elevating course conditioning, executing infrastructure improvements, and fostering a strong workplace culture aligned with the club’s values and mission.

About

Us

Founded in 1970, The Pines Country Club is one of West Virginia’s most established private clubs, known for its scenic layout, vibrant membership, and active year-round calendar of golf and social events. The club’s rolling terrain and mature tree lines provide a challenging and enjoyable experience for members and guests alike. With a forward-looking Board and Green Committee, The Pines is committed to investing in its course infrastructure, equipment, and people to ensure long-term excellence.

Club

Highlights
  • Total Annual Rounds: 24,000

  • Membership: 460 Golfing, 100 Social, 60 Club

  • 2025 Maintenance Budget: $1.3 Million

  • Upcoming Projects:
    Sand channel drainage on greens, tree removal

  • Irrigation System:
    Toro 2-line system; water source from Cheat Lake; pump station under review

  • Turf Types:
    Bent/Poa greens; bent/Poa fairways and tees

  • Equipment:
    Mixed fleet (purchase/lease program under review)

  • Staffing Structure:
    Full-time, seasonal, and part-time employees (expected mix 10–12 FTEs)

  • Green Committee:
    Active, meeting monthly
    Reports:
    Board Liaison
